DevCloudly logo

Unlocking the Power: Elastic Cloud and Machine Learning Synergy

Elastic Cloud Infrastructure
Elastic Cloud Infrastructure

Overview of Elastic Cloud and Machine Learning

Key features of elastic cloud include auto-scaling capabilities, which allow resources to adjust automatically to workload fluctuations, ensuring optimal performance and cost-effectiveness. Additionally, elastic cloud offers high availability, fault tolerance, and elastic storage, enabling seamless deployment and management of machine learning models in a cloud environment.

Use cases of elastic cloud in machine learning range from training predictive models and processing real-time data streams to image recognition and natural language processing. By leveraging elastic cloud, organizations can accelerate time-to-insight, improve decision-making, and enhance the accuracy and scalability of their machine learning initiatives.

Best Practices

When implementing elastic cloud for machine learning, industry best practices focus on optimizing resource utilization, monitoring performance metrics, and prioritizing data security. Organizations are advised to adopt a cloud-native approach, utilizing managed services and serverless computing to streamline development workflows and minimize operational overhead.

To maximize efficiency and productivity, teams should establish clear governance policies, automate repetitive tasks, and leverage containerization technologies for portability and consistency. Common pitfalls to avoid include underestimating resource requirements, neglecting data governance, and overlooking compliance regulations when deploying machine learning workloads in a cloud environment.

Case Studies

Real-world examples of successful implementation demonstrate how organizations have leveraged elastic cloud for machine learning to achieve significant outcomes. From predictive maintenance in manufacturing to personalized recommendations in e-commerce, these case studies highlight the transformative impact of cloud-based machine learning solutions.

Lessons learned from industry experts underscore the importance of cloud architecture design, data management best practices, and continuous performance optimization. By integrating elastic cloud resources with advanced machine learning algorithms, businesses can unlock new insights, drive innovation, and gain a competitive edge in their respective markets.

Latest Trends and Updates

As the field of elastic cloud and machine learning evolves, upcoming advancements focus on edge computing, federated learning, and increased integration of AI technologies. Current industry trends indicate a shift towards hybrid cloud environments, quantum computing capabilities, and enhanced security protocols for sensitive data processing.

Innovations and breakthroughs in elastic cloud and machine learning pave the way for augmented intelligence, autonomous systems, and personalized user experiences. Enterprises that stay abreast of these trends and incorporate them into their technology roadmap can position themselves for future success and adaptability in the rapidly changing digital landscape.

How-To Guides and Tutorials

For beginners and advanced users alike, step-by-step guides offer practical insights into leveraging elastic cloud for machine learning applications. These tutorials cover topics such as setting up cloud-based development environments, deploying machine learning models using container orchestration platforms, and fine-tuning algorithms for optimal performance.

Hands-on tutorials provide interactive demonstrations of data preprocessing, model training, and deployment best practices in a cloud-native ecosystem. Practical tips and tricks focus on streamlining workflows, troubleshooting common issues, and optimizing cost efficiency in machine learning projects running on elastic cloud infrastructure.

Introduction

Machine Learning Algorithms
Machine Learning Algorithms

In the realm of digital transformation, the fusion of elastic cloud technology with machine learning stands out as a pivotal advancement. This article aims to dissect the symbiotic relationship between elastic cloud and machine learning applications, unraveling the intricacies and implications of this amalgamation. By delving into the core tenets of these two domains, we can unearth the fundamental constructs that underpin their convergence and elucidate the transformative potential they hold in reshaping the technological landscape.

Defining Elastic Cloud and Machine Learning

Elastic cloud, in essence, refers to a scalable and flexible cloud computing model that enables dynamic resource allocation based on demand fluctuations. This adaptability is pivotal in optimizing resource utilization and enhancing cost-efficiency for organizations. On the other hand, machine learning comprises a subset of artificial intelligence that empowers systems to learn and improve from experience without explicit programming. By harnessing algorithms and statistical models, machine learning algorithms can process and analyze vast amounts of data to extract valuable insights and facilitate informed decision-making.

Significance of Integration

The integration of elastic cloud and machine learning heralds a new era of innovation and efficiency. This convergence unlocks a myriad of opportunities for organizations to leverage the scalability and computational prowess of elastic cloud environments to bolster their machine learning initiatives. By seamlessly integrating these technologies, enterprises can streamline their data processing pipelines, accelerate model training, and scale computational resources on-demand. This symbiosis not only enhances operational agility but also augments the robustness and efficacy of machine learning algorithms, paving the way for data-driven decision-making and predictive analytics.

Overview of the Article

This article embarks on a comprehensive exploration of the intersection between elastic cloud and machine learning, traversing through the foundational concepts, practical implications, and future prospects of this synergistic alliance. From delineating the benefits of elastic cloud for machine learning applications to elucidating the challenges associated with this integration, each section offers a nuanced perspective on how organizations can harness the combined power of these technologies to drive innovation and achieve competitive advantage in the digital age.

Foundations of Elastic Cloud Technology

In the domain of modern digital infrastructure, understanding the underpinnings of elastic cloud technology holds paramount importance. Foundations of elastic cloud refer to the fundamental principles and infrastructural components that enable the dynamic scaling and flexible resource allocation characteristic of cloud computing. This section serves as the cornerstone for comprehending how elastic cloud interfaces with machine learning applications, offering a robust platform for deploying and managing ML algorithms.

Scalability in Elastic Cloud

In the realm of elastic cloud technology, scalability stands out as a pivotal attribute that distinguishes it from traditional IT infrastructure. Scalability entails the ability of a system to handle increasing workloads and accommodate growing demands seamlessly. Within the context of elastic cloud, scalability empowers organizations to expand or contract their computational resources elastically based on fluctuating ML workloads and requirements. This dynamic scalability ensures efficient utilization of resources, prevents bottlenecks, and fosters agility in deploying machine learning models.

Resource Management

Resource management in elastic cloud environments is a strategic imperative for optimizing performance and cost-efficiency. Effective resource management involves monitoring, provisioning, and allocating computational resources judiciously to meet the demands of machine learning workloads. By leveraging automation and intelligent resource allocation algorithms, organizations can streamline operations, enhance productivity, and ensure optimal utilization of cloud resources for machine learning tasks.

Cost Efficiency

Cost efficiency underscores the significance of prudent resource allocation and utilization in elastic cloud deployments. In the context of machine learning applications, cost efficiency pertains to optimizing cloud spending while maintaining performance and scalability. By adopting cost-effective strategies such as auto-scaling, pay-as-you-go models, and resource pooling, businesses can mitigate unnecessary expenses, align resource consumption with workload demands, and enhance the overall economic viability of elastic cloud-based machine learning initiatives.

Machine Learning Fundamentals

Data Scalability in Elastic Cloud
Data Scalability in Elastic Cloud

Supervised Learning

Supervised learning within the machine learning paradigm involves training a model on labeled data to predict outcomes accurately. This approach requires a clear understanding of input-output relationships, providing the algorithm with a dataset where the desired output is known. By leveraging labeled data, supervised learning algorithms can make predictions based on patterns identified during the training phase. In the context of elastic cloud technology, supervised learning plays a crucial role in building predictive models, classification tasks, and regression analyses. Organizations can harness supervised learning algorithms to streamline operational processes, improve customer experience, and drive business growth through data-driven decision-making.

Unsupervised Learning

Contrary to supervised learning, unsupervised learning focuses on extracting meaningful insights from unlabeled data. Instead of predefined outcomes, unsupervised learning algorithms identify inherent patterns and structures within the data. By applying clustering or association techniques, organizations can reveal hidden patterns, trends, and anomalies in large datasets. This unsupervised approach is particularly valuable for segmenting customer bases, detecting fraud, and optimizing resource allocation. When integrated with elastic cloud technology, unsupervised learning empowers businesses to uncover actionable insights, enhance data exploration, and drive innovation through a deeper understanding of underlying data relationships.

Reinforcement Learning

Reinforcement learning represents a dynamic approach within machine learning where an agent learns to make sequential decisions to achieve a predefined goal through trial and error. By interacting with an environment and receiving feedback, the agent refines its decision-making capabilities to maximize long-term rewards. In the context of elastic cloud and machine learning integration, reinforcement learning finds applications in optimizing resource allocation, self-adaptive systems, and personalized recommendations. This learning paradigm enables systems to adapt to evolving environments, exploit opportunities, and continuously improve performance through autonomous decision-making processes.

Integration of Elastic Cloud and Machine Learning

In this section, we delve into the crucial aspect of integrating elastic cloud technology with machine learning applications. This intersection holds immense significance in the modern technological landscape, where businesses are leveraging advanced tools to optimize processes and drive innovation. Understanding the specific elements of this integration is paramount for maximizing the benefits offered by both elastic cloud and machine learning.

Benefits of Elastic Cloud for

Elastic cloud platforms present a plethora of benefits for machine learning operations. Firstly, scalability is a key advantage, allowing resources to automatically adjust based on computing needs. This dynamic scaling ensures optimal performance and cost-efficiency for ML tasks. Secondly, resource management is streamlined through elastic cloud solutions, enabling efficient allocation of computational resources for diverse machine learning algorithms. Lastly, cost efficiency is a notable benefit, as organizations can avoid over-provisioning by only paying for utilized resources, maximizing return on investment.

Challenges and Solutions

Despite the advantages, integrating elastic cloud with machine learning poses certain challenges. One notable issue is data security and privacy concerns when transferring sensitive datasets to cloud environments. Organizations must implement robust encryption and access control measures to mitigate these risks effectively. Additionally, the complexity of managing hybrid infrastructures can lead to operational challenges. Implementing automated management solutions and clear governance frameworks can address these issues, ensuring smooth integration of elastic cloud with machine learning processes.

Best Practices

To optimize the integration of elastic cloud and machine learning, following best practices is essential. Organizations should prioritize data governance and compliance measures to maintain regulatory standards while leveraging cloud resources for ML tasks. Implementing monitoring and optimization tools can help track performance metrics and fine-tune resource utilization for optimal results. Furthermore, fostering a culture of collaboration between data scientists and IT professionals fosters innovation and enhances the efficiency of machine learning workflows. By adhering to these best practices, businesses can harness the full potential of elastic cloud technology for machine learning applications.

Real-World Applications

Real-world applications of the intersection of elastic cloud and machine learning are pivotal in showcasing the practical implications and benefits of this integration. Embracing these applications provides a profound understanding of how elastic cloud can revolutionize machine learning practices in various industries.

Optimizing Machine Learning Models
Optimizing Machine Learning Models

Healthcare Industry

Within the healthcare industry, the utilization of elastic cloud and machine learning has led to significant advancements in medical diagnostics, treatment customization, and patient care. Elastic cloud technologies enable healthcare providers to process vast amounts of patient data efficiently, leading to quicker and more accurate diagnoses. Machine learning algorithms can analyze complex medical data to predict potential health risks in patients, optimize treatment plans, and enhance overall healthcare outcomes. By integrating elastic cloud capabilities with machine learning, healthcare organizations can improve operational efficiency, patient experiences, and clinical outcomes.

Financial Sector

In the financial sector, the integration of elastic cloud with machine learning has transformed the landscape of banking, investment, and risk management. Elastic cloud solutions enhance the scalability and speed of financial operations, enabling institutions to process massive volumes of financial data in real-time. Machine learning algorithms can detect fraud, assess credit risks, and personalize financial services for customers. This integration enables financial institutions to make data-driven decisions swiftly, mitigate risks, and deliver tailored financial products and services. By leveraging the combined power of elastic cloud and machine learning, the financial sector can enhance security, efficiency, and customer satisfaction.

E-commerce Optimization

E-commerce optimization benefits significantly from the fusion of elastic cloud and machine learning technologies. By leveraging elastic cloud resources, e-commerce platforms can scale operations dynamically to meet fluctuating demands, ensuring optimal performance during peak traffic periods. Machine learning algorithms analyze user behavior, preferences, and purchasing patterns to provide personalized recommendations, enhance customer engagement, and optimize marketing strategies. The integration of elastic cloud with machine learning empowers e-commerce businesses to enhance user experiences, streamline operations, and drive revenue growth. Through continuous data analysis and resource optimization, e-commerce platforms can adapt swiftly to market trends and customer preferences, making the most of elastic cloud and machine learning capabilities.

Future Trends and Innovations

In the realm of elastic cloud technology and machine learning, keeping a vigilant eye on future trends and innovations is paramount. The fast-paced nature of technological advancements necessitates continuous evolution and adaptation. Within the context of this article, exploring future trends and innovations unveils a landscape rich with possibilities and challenges. By delving into cutting-edge developments, we gain a nuanced understanding of where the synergy between elastic cloud and machine learning is heading.

AutoML Advancements

AutoML, short for Automated Machine Learning, stands at the forefront of revolutionizing the machine learning workflow. Its significance lies in automating the manual process of hyperparameter tuning, model selection, and feature engineering. This streamlines the machine learning pipeline, significantly reducing time and resources required for model development. AutoML advancements pave the way for democratizing machine learning, enabling individuals with varied technical backgrounds to leverage sophisticated models effortlessly. Embracing AutoML enhancements signifies embracing efficiency and scalability in machine learning endeavors.

Cloud-native Machine Learning

The concept of cloud-native machine learning embodies the paradigm shift towards deploying machine learning models in cloud environments seamlessly. This approach leverages the agility and scalability of cloud infrastructure to enhance the machine learning lifecycle. By adopting cloud-native practices, organizations can achieve greater computational efficiency, scalability, and collaboration in their machine learning projects. The seamless integration of machine learning pipelines with cloud resources empowers data scientists and developers to focus on model innovation rather than infrastructure management. Cloud-native machine learning heralds a new era of flexibility and optimization in deploying machine learning solutions.

Edge Computing Integration

The integration of edge computing with elastic cloud and machine learning heralds a transformative era in decentralized processing and decision-making. Edge computing entails enabling data processing closer to the data source, reducing latency and enhancing efficiency. Integrating edge computing with elastic cloud architecture optimizes real-time data analysis for machine learning applications, particularly in resource-constrained environments. This fusion facilitates rapid decision-making and response, crucial in scenarios requiring low latency and high data volumes. Edge computing integration augments the capabilities of elastic cloud and machine learning, paving the way for enhanced performance and functionality in edge-based applications.

Conclusion

In this final section of the article, we bring together the intricate relationship between Elastic Cloud and Machine Learning. The significance of understanding the synergy between these two domains cannot be overstated in today’s tech-driven world. We have explored how Elastic Cloud technology enhances the capabilities of Machine Learning applications, offering a scalable, cost-effective, and efficient solution for processing vast amounts of data. The seamless integration of Elastic Cloud and Machine Learning opens up a realm of possibilities for industries across the spectrum.

Key Takeaways

As we reflect on the journey through the Intersection of Elastic Cloud and Machine Learning, several key points emerge. Firstly, the fusion of these technologies presents a game-changing opportunity for organizations to leverage cloud resources for optimizing Machine Learning workflows. Secondly, the adoption of Elastic Cloud minimizes resource constraints and boosts the scalability of Machine Learning models. Lastly, embracing best practices in Elastic Cloud utilization is crucial for ensuring the success of Machine Learning initiatives in diverse industry verticals.

As we delve into the depths of this subject matter, it becomes evident that the coalescence of Elastic Cloud and Machine Learning is not merely a trend but a strategic imperative for staying competitive in the digital landscape. This article serves as a foundational guide for software developers, IT professionals, data scientists, and tech enthusiasts seeking to unlock the potential of Elastic Cloud technology in driving innovation and efficiency in Machine Learning applications.

Abstract Code Security
Abstract Code Security
🔒 Explore advanced Github security measures in this insightful article, uncovering cutting-edge features to strengthen your repository defense. Learn how to protect your code from threats and adhere to industry standards for enhanced security practices. 🛡️
Java Code Structure Abstraction
Java Code Structure Abstraction
Uncover the nuances of Java code with this inclusive guide, delving into fundamental principles, best practices, and advanced techniques 🚀 Enhance your coding proficiency from syntax to data structures for improved efficiency.